Host Laura Reid welcomes Divorce Coach and Yoga Instructor Audrey Alice to the show to talk about her scariest speeches and how she slayed her fear. After surviving Laura’s Killer 13 opening questions, Audrey shares her story of divorce, the speech that made her cry in the car, and how she learned to push through her fear. Laura and Audrey shine a light into the dark and explore Audrey’s new purpose in life and her current enjoyment of public speaking.
Audrey’s divorce and the challenges she faced after that significant change in her life brought her to a place where she needed to confront public speaking in order to promote her new business. She describes being so frightened she was shaking and crying in her car, too afraid to go in and face the 50 people she needed to address for 60 seconds. She did the 60-second talk anyway and lived to tell. Laura lets us peek behind the curtain of Audrey’s life to see how she became comfortable with public speaking and why it’s so important to her that her message of hope after divorce reaches as many people as possible.
About Audrey Alice:
Audrey Alice is a happily divorced mama of 3 sons. Going through her own divorce when her boys were 5, 8, and 11 made her realize that there wasn’t much out there in terms of support or information on how to navigate the next chapter, especially with young kids. And being the first in her friendship circle to get a divorce, she didn’t know many people who could relate to her story.
Because Audrey made mistakes and learned the hard way, she decided that no woman (or man!) would have to take the long road to healing, so she became a Divorce Coach to help others through divorce with grace.
When she graduated high school, Audrey wanted to study to become an international translator for organizations like NATO but her father convinced her that hospitality would be a wiser choice. She ended up working in deluxe 5-star hotels for 20 years before becoming a full-time mum when her second child was born.
After her divorce, Audrey originally trained as a Nutrition Coach but pivoted after a year to Divorce Coach. She is also a yoga instructor and reiki practitioner and has lived on 3 continents, in 8 countries and speaks 4 languages.
